According to the South African National Census of 2011, there were almost four million first language Sesotho speakers recorded in South Africa – approximately eight per cent of the population. Most Sesotho speakers in South Africa reside in Free State and Gauteng. WebSpanish Tutors Online Live Lingua WebFeb 23, 2024 · The official languages of the Kingdom of Lesotho are Sesotho and English. [1] Sotho or Sesotho is spoken primarily by the Basotho in Lesotho, where it is the national and official language. [2] Sesotho - Official language - Sesotho is the first language of more than 90 percent of the population and is "used widely as a medium of communication ...

WebTswana speaking ethnic groups are found in more than two provinces of South Africa, primarily in the North West, where about four million people speak the language. An urbanised variety, which is part slang and not the formal Setswana, is known as Pretoria Sotho, and is the principal unique language of the city of Pretoria.
